The Nissan 161185E400 Throttle Body Sensor is a crucial component for maintaining the smooth and efficient operation of your 1995-1997 Nissan Altima with a 2.4L engine. This sensor plays a vital role in the vehicle's fuel-injection system by providing critical data to the engine control unit (ECU) about the throttle position.
This O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) part is precision-engineered to meet the exacting standards of Nissan. It features a robust, high-quality design with a durable construction that is designed to withstand the demands of everyday driving. The sensor is equipped with a sensitive and accurate potentiometer that detects the angle of the throttle plate, ensuring precise fuel delivery and smooth engine performance.

3. Improves engine performance: A faulty throttle body sensor can cause various issues like a rough idle, stalling, or difficulty accelerating. Replacing it with a new one can help restore your engine's performance.
